How much do total physical therapy j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for total physical therapy in the United States is $31.95,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.92 and $35.58 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by physical therapists working in a total physical therapy clinic, and how can they be addressed?

Physical therapists in a total physical therapy clinic often encounter challenges such as managing a diverse caseload, balancing administrative paperwork with patient care, and keeping up with advancements in treatment techniques. Addressing these challenges involves effective time management, ongoing professional development, and collaboration with colleagues for shared problem-solving. Many clinics also use electronic health records and team meetings to streamline workflows, ensuring therapists can focus more on patient outcomes while maintaining documentation stand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Physical Therapist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Physical Therapist, you need a strong understanding of anatomy, physiology, and therapeutic techniques, backed by a Doctor of Physical Therapy (DPT) degree and a state license. Familiarity with rehabilitation equipment, electronic medical records (EMR), and clinical documentation systems is essential. Outstanding interpersonal skills, empathy, and effective communication help build trust and motivate patients during recovery. These competencies ensure evidence-based care, patient engagement, and successful rehabilitation outcomes.

What field of PT makes the most money?

In physical therapy, specialized roles such as orthopedic, sports, or neurology physical therapists tend to earn higher salaries due to advanced skills and certifications. Outpatient clinics and private practices often offer higher compensation compared to other settings, especially for therapists with additional certifications or extensive experience.

What is Total Physical Therapy?

Total Physical Therapy is a healthcare service focused on evaluating, diagnosing, and treating physical impairments, disabilities, and pain through various therapeutic techniques. It aims to restore function, improve mobility, relieve pain, and prevent or limit permanent physical disabilities in patients. Physical therapists at Total Physical Therapy work with individuals of all ages to develop personalized treatment plans, often including exercises, manual therapy, and education on injury prevention. This comprehensive approach helps patients recover from injuries, surgeries, or chronic conditions while enhancing their overall quality of life.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

  1. Assist the physician in the evaluation of the patient to determine the physical therapy necessary by applying diagnostic and prognostic muscle, nerve, joint and functional ability tests.
  2. Under the physicianโ€™s order, treat patients to relieve pain, develop or restore function and maintain optimal performance using physical means such as heat, water, electricity, light, massage, etc.
  3. Aid and direct patients in active and passive exercises, muscle re-education, gait and functional training, activities of daily living, and prosthetic training.
  4. Give whirlpool and contrast baths, applies moist heat, intermittent traction, ultra-sound, short wave diathermy, etc.
  5. Observes, records, and reports patientโ€™s reaction to treatment and any changes in the patientโ€™s condition.
  6. Instructs patients in the care and use of wheelchairs, walkers, braces, canes, crutches and prosthetic and orthotic devices.
  7. Collaborates with other health professionals to coordinate clinical intervention.
  8. Instructs the family in the patientโ€™s total physical therapy program.
  9. Serves as a member of the patient care team.
  10. Records a progress note which is incorporated in the patientโ€™s medical record for each visit.
  11. Based on physicianโ€™s orders, develops, implements, and revises the plan of treatment as necessary.
  12. Participates in education programs to improve therapy skills.
  13. Supervises student interns, PTLAs, physical therapy assistants, physical therapy aides and volunteers in compliance with State laws and regulations and Burger policies and procedures as assigned.
